Social Rented Housing

Asked by Rachael MaskellLabour (Co-op)Ministry of Housing, Communities and Local GovernmentTabled Answered 10 June 2025UIN 56267

The question

To ask the Secretary of State for Housing, Communities and Local Government, if she will make an estimate of the number of people in the private rented sector due to a lack of social housing.

Answered by Matthew Pennycook

According to the most recent data from the English Housing Survey from 2022/23, 6% (280,000) of Household Reference Persons in the private rented sector reported that someone in their home is on the waiting list for social housing.
